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Practical Metal Finishing - More often than not, metal finishing is essential for appearance or for clean-room applications. It is one of the more favored methods due to its utility in intensifying the overall attractiveness of the item, for example, motor bike parts, motor vehicle parts or kitchenware. Aside from that, a lot of clean-rooms need a lustrous finish so as to decrease the porosity of the components which may cause particles to gather and contaminate. A great example of this application could be in a vacuum chamber. You'll discover plenty of different ways to polish metal, and we shall look at examples of the steps required. Metals may be finished electromechanically, by means of chemicals, manually, or with purpose built buffing machines. A special polishing compound or paste could be employed, which might include aluminum oxide, tripoli, limestone, chalk, chromium oxide, dolomite,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, because of its below average th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its comparatively high viscosity is usually one of the most time-consuming. More over, products made out of non-ferrous metals are generally more responsive to finishing, since these require the lowest amount of procedures.
Where a greater processing quality is simply not required, quicker pad speeds can be used. A reduced pad speed must be used any time a quality mirror finish is expected. Finishing buffs covered with paste will be very much affected by specific pressure on the finishing pad. The level of the surface pressure could be heightened within certain boundaries, although further exceeding the optimum level of pressure not only reduces the quality level of treatment, but additionally decreases the level of effectiveness, could result in wear to the component, plus there is also a significant heating of the pieces being worked on, brought about by friction. When you are working on thin metal, it's increased heat (and a resulting pliancy of the metal) that may cause items to buckle, distort or warp. Normally, it will require a skilled polisher to take into consideration every one of these points to both avoid harm to the workpiece and to perform competently. To be able to substantially improve the quality of the resultant surface, the finishing process really should be done with a lesser amount of aggression and not a large amount of force to be able to consequently complete a surface area that is free of scratches or fine lines caused by the finishing procedure, thus ending up with a lovely mirror finish.
